Lucky recipients were winners of a competition run by Deliveroo and Leeds United earlier this year

This week, Leeds united legend Jermaine Beckford showed up to the homes of four lucky fans in Leeds with a special delivery ahead of the Championship kick off this Saturday.

Earlier this year, Deliveroo partnered with Leeds United to run a competition where fans could win a shirt signed by each of the first-team players. The four lucky winners were contacted by email earlier this week to say they had won the competition, but had no idea their Deliveroo rider would be accompanied by Leeds legend Jermaine Beckford.

The former striker for Leeds United thanked each winner for their support of the club, making sure to keep socially distanced at all times. The fans were also given a shirt signed by every member of the first-team, including team captain Liam Cooper, Kalvin Phillips and Luke Ayling.

One of the competition winners, Chelsey said “When I opened the door I was so shocked to see Jermaine standing there, it was completely unexpected! My boyfriend is a HUGE Leeds fan so I had to bring him to the door too, we were both shaking like mad and couldn’t stop smiling! 

“My winning order was actually things from the CO-OP, which has been a massive help to us throughout lockdown due to us not being able to get out and delivery slots being so limited elsewhere! Deliveroo has really helped with that.

“We love football in this house so the Championship returning means we will get the joy (let’s face it, some disappointment too) that football brings, it will also be so nice to have that bit of normality back in our lives during these times."

Paul Bell, Executive Director at Leeds United, said: “Ever since we entered into a partnership with Deliveroo we have enjoyed a great relationship and produced some engaging content For the fans, from the Helder Costa signing announcement to the Ask series which has exceeded 1.5 million views during the lockdown period so far. When we looked to send out the signed shirts won by Deliveroo competition winners we knew we needed to come up with a fun way of doing so, and what better way than sending a modern day Leeds United legend in the form of Jermaine.”

Last year, Leeds United Football Club announced a new and extended partnership agreement with Deliveroo, as they became the club’s official training kit partner for the 2019/20 season. The on-going partnership with Leeds United was Deliveroo’s first sponsorship within the football industry, and saw the Deliveroo logo featured on all first-team player and coaching staff training wear throughout the campaign.
